Cyient rises as its arm concludes acquisition of Blom Aerofilms

Cyient’s wholly owned subsidiary Cyient Europe, UK, has concluded acquisition of 100% equity in Blom Aerofilms, Cheddar, Somerset, England, a leading geospatial services provider, effective from November 30, 2016.

Earlier, in November, Cyient Europe, UK, had signed a definitive agreement to acquire 100% equity in Blom Aerofilms, Cheddar, Somerset, England, a leading geospatial services provider.

Cyient, formerly Infotech Enterprises is a company focussed on engineering, networks and operations. The company features among the top 30 outsourcing companies in the world.
